As one of our Defined Contribution Retirement Consultants, you’ll play a critical role in helping investors save for retirement. You are motivated by setting goals and measuring your performance against them. You’ll collaborate with Retirement Plan Counselors in the field and financial advisors and consultants that specialize in the Defined Contribution marketplace to identify new opportunities for Capital Group.

You’re well-versed in synthesizing information and presenting it in a distilled manner. You’ll initiate sales and present compelling solutions to promote American Funds and the placement of our investments within fund menus.

I am the person Capital Group is looking for.”

  • You provide specialized internal consultation to retirement‑plan–heavy advisors, sharing thought leadership, investment insights, and guidance that strengthens relationships and develops retirement sales opportunities.

  • You identify gaps and develop solutions for plan opportunities, considering pricing, product fit, competitive dynamics, and territory nuances.

  • You cultivate new relationships with assigned prospects, building strong pipelines that drive future retirement plan opportunities.

  • You serve as a subject‑matter expert for advisors and consultants, addressing questions and objections related to retirement plans and the role of American Funds within plan lineups, while uncovering additional opportunities.

  • You represent the American Funds Client Group at industry events, participating in conferences, hosting webinars and calls, and delivering presentations to advisors and financial professionals virtually and in-person.

  • You stay current on retirement industry trends and resources, analyzing potential impacts on territory teams and incorporating new insights, offerings, or products into advisor discussions.

  • You advance opportunities toward point‑of‑sale outcomes, driving Capital Group placement within new or existing retirement plans.

  • You must hold your SIE to apply and either hold/obtain Series, 7 & 66
